区块链的灵魂和共识是什么,这是一个深刻而重

区块链的灵魂:去中心化的理念

区块链的灵魂可以说是去中心化这一理念。在传统的中心化系统中,数据和控制权都集中在某个特定的实体手中,比如银行、公司或政府。当这些实体出现失误或不诚信时,用户的信任会受到严重打击。而区块链通过分散数据存储和管理,允许参与者共同维护网络,消除了单点故障和信任问题。

由于所有参与者共同维护账本,任何人都可以验证交易的真实性。这种去中心化的特征使得区块链在进行价值转移时,能够省去中介的介入,从而降低交易成本,提升效率。举例来说,比特币就是一个典型的去中心化数字货币,用户可以直接在没有中介的情况下进行交易。

共识机制:确保区块链安全和信任的基石

共识机制是区块链网络中至关重要的一部分,它确保所有的参与者在同一时间对网络状态达成一致,从而确保数据的一致性和安全性。常见的共识机制有工作量证明(PoW)、权益证明(PoS)、授权证明(DPoS)等。

以工作量证明(PoW)为例,矿工们通过解决复杂的数学问题来竞争记账权,首先解决问题的矿工能够将新的区块添加到区块链中,并获得一定数量的数字货币作为奖励。这种机制可以有效地防止恶意攻击,因为如果想要控制网络,攻击者需要投入巨大的计算资源。

权益证明(PoS)则通过选出拥有更多代币的用户来保证网络的安全性。持有代币越多,获得参与记账的概率就越高。虽然PoS的能耗相对较低,但也会引起“富者愈富”的问题,因为持有较多代币的人更容易获得新的代币。

区块链灵魂与共识的互动关系

区块链的灵魂和共识机制是密不可分的。去中心化使得网络更具透明度和安全性,而共识机制则是实现这种去中心化的实际操作方法。没有共识机制,区块链就无法抵御数据篡改和网络攻击,也无法确保各方的权益。

例如,当网络中的某些节点尝试传播有害数据时,其他节点可以通过共识算法迅速识别并拒绝这些数据。通过不断地收集和验证数据,网络能够保持一致性,避免数据的失真。

常见区块链的去中心化会带来哪些优势?

去中心化的优势首先在于增强的安全性。由于数据分布在全球数以千计的节点上,即使某一部分节点遭到攻击,整个网络也能正常运行。此外,去中心化有效地降低了单点故障的风险,提高了系统的可靠性。

其次,去中心化可以增强透明度和信任。由于所有的交易记录都公开并且不可篡改,用户可以更放心地使用区块链技术。这种透明性使得不诚实的行为更难隐藏,从而提升了各方之间的信任。

最后,去中心化有助于降低交易成本。在许多现有的金融和法律系统中,通常需要中介进行监督和验证,而区块链可以通过共识机制直接让用户进行交易,省去了中间环节的费用和时间。

常见共识机制存在哪些局限性?

尽管共识机制在保障区块链运行过程中发挥了重要作用,但它们也存在一定的局限性。首先,工作量证明(PoW)机制遭到了严重的环境影响,因为它需要大量的计算能力,导致高能耗和资源浪费。这引发了人们对其可持续性的担忧,特别是在气候变化日益严峻的背景下。

其次,权益证明(PoS)虽然在能耗上具有优势,但却可能导致“中央化”的问题。由于获得记账权的可能性与所拥有代币的数量成正比,持有大量代币的用户将更容易获得记账权,从而有可能影响网络的公平性。

此外,高参与门槛和复杂的算法也可能限制普通用户的参与热情,降低了区块链网络的去中心化特性。这使得共识机制的设计成为一个重要的研究课题,如何平衡效率与公平性是当前的一个挑战。

常见区块链的未来发展方向是什么?

随着区块链技术的不断发展,其未来方向将会更加多样化。一方面,区块链有可能与人工智能、物联网等新兴技术相结合,创造出更为智能、安全的生态系统。例如,通过区块链技术,IoT设备的数据可以安全快速地进行验证和交换,从而提升智能合约的使用效率。

另一方面,新的共识机制的研究将成为未来发展的重点。如何在保证安全性和去中心化的前提下,提升网络的效率和环保性,将是各大项目组需面对的挑战。像分片技术和层次化结构等方案,有望解决目前区块链面临的扩展性问题。

同时,区块链的合规性和标准化也是一个关键问题。随着政府和监管机构对区块链的关注增加,如何在享受去中心化带来的好处的同时,遵循法律法规是各方必须认真对待的事情。

常见普通用户如何参与区块链?

普通用户参与区块链的方式多种多样,首先是通过投资参与数字货币交易。用户可以在多个交易平台上进行代币的买卖,虽然投资基于市场波动可能带来风险,但通常也是普通用户较为常见的参与方式。

此外,用户还可以通过参与区块链项目的社区,了解更多关于技术和应用的信息。许多区块链项目都会设立社区论坛和社交媒体平台,用户可以在这里分享经验、提问以及获得最新的项目动态。

参与挖矿也是另一种途径,虽然对普通用户的计算机硬件有一定的要求,但随着云计算服务的崛起,访问云端挖矿服务变得越来越便捷。用户可以租用算力,将资源用于挖矿。

最后,普通用户还可以通过使用基于区块链的应用程序,体验去中心化带来的便利。例如,各种去中心化金融(DeFi)工具和应用均为用户提供了参与金融活动的新方式,比如借贷、交易等。

总结

区块链的灵魂在于其去中心化的理念,而共识机制则是实现这一理念的骨干。无论是从安全性、透明度,还是成本效益的角度来看,区块链都展示了其巨大的潜力。但同时,共识机制的限制、新技术的研究方向以及普通用户的参与方式也为其未来发展提供了丰富的讨论方向。只有不断创新和适应,区块链才能在广泛的应用场景中发挥更大的作用。

通过了解区块链的灵魂和共识机制,每一位参与者都能更深刻地认识到这一技术带来的变革和机遇。希望未来能够看到更多创新的应用,并推动整个社会朝着去中心化、透明和高效的方向前进。